Over the weekend, reports claimed that a group of investors were in 'advanced talks' to acquire EA in a deal worth roughly $50 billion. Now, EA has confirmed this to be true, with plans to sell to a consortium of investors for $55 billion.

UK games studio, Splash Damage, is splitting off from Tencent. The company had been acquired by a Chinese company in 2016, which was then acquired by Tencent in 2020. Borderlands 4 may very well be the best entry in the much-loved looter-shooter franchise. Unfortunately, the game stumbled out of the gate somewhat with a plethora of optimisation issues, performance woes, bugs and a lack of options on console. Though there is still work to be done, Gearbox have now released their first big post-launch patch, introducing stability and performance improvements, refinements, and an FOV slider on console.
